How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 91402?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 91402 Studio Apartments | $1,746 | $1,000 | $2,200 |
| 91402 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,913 | $1,300 | $2,599 |
| 91402 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,502 | $1,824 | $2,895 |
| 91402 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,896 | $2,600 | $3,495 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 91402 ZIP Code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in 91402?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in 91402 with Swimming Pool is at Heron Pond 55+ Apartments listed at $960.
How much is the average rent for 91402 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in 91402 with Swimming Pool is $2,134.
What is the largest 91402 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in 91402 is a 1,877 square feet unit starting from $1,541 at Town Treeline.
What is the average size for 91402 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in 91402 is currently at 695 sq ft.
